Well, it will usually taper back a little by redline, however 12psi taper is too much. Did you do a boost leak test to check for any problems in the system? It is good you got the pills out of the lines, but something isn't right setup wise if you are losing that much pressure every time.
Well with my 3 port I am able to hit 27 psi and then I taper to 20 or so by redline. You will see some who hold 19-21 until redline and no more. This is because of the flow characteristics of the turbo.

1. The boost pill would be used with the stock BCS, not ever with the MBC.
2. You will always taper at the far end of the rev range, you cannot do much about that at this time.

It's because you are at altitude and you haven't adjusted your boost/vacuum data logging item in EvoScan. I have mine calibrated to about -12.65 rather than -14.5. That will show the actual positive pressure up here (it will show higher once adjusted). Also, you'll never see as much boost up top at 4500 ft as you do at sea level. I saw 21 psi at redline at sea level, and only 19.5 up here. Be VERY wary of turning your boost up beyond 25 psi here, I've lost my turbo in the last 10k miles because I've been running 28+ psi at altitude. The pressure ratio becomes higher with the less dense base air given the same boost pressure (the compressor has to spin faster to achieve the same amount of boost).
